Corporate and Commercial Architectural Design
We create professional environments that balance structural functionality with brand identity, emphasizing durability and natural light.
The lobby for Torishima Pumps was designed to be open and filled with light, featuring floor-to-ceiling glass walls and polished granite flooring. The minimalist design and clean lines create a sleek, professional first impression.
At Komet India, the reception area is defined by a curved wooden desk and a grand staircase leading to the upper floors. The combination of polished stone, wood, and metal creates a modern and sophisticated corporate environment.
This view of the multi-level interior at Komet India shows how we use open mezzanines and minimalist steel railings to maintain visual connection between floors. This approach fosters a sense of openness and collaboration within the workspace.
About Corporate & Commercial Architecture
Selecting materials for high-traffic commercial spaces requires a balance between aesthetic intent and long-term maintenance. In our corporate work, we prioritize materials like polished granite and toughened glass not just for their clean, modern look, but for their ability to withstand heavy daily use while maintaining a professional appearance.
Architectural Strategy for Corporate Spaces
We approach commercial design by analyzing movement and work patterns. Whether the project is a manufacturing facility or a corporate headquarters, the architecture must support the user. Our process begins with space planning that optimizes flow, ensuring that lobbies, workspaces, and atriums are not only visually impressive but also operationally efficient.
Materiality and Durability
For commercial interiors, we select materials that perform under pressure. Polished granite flooring offers a professional, low-maintenance foundation for high-traffic lobbies, such as the one we designed for Torishima Pumps. Toughened glass partitions provide openness and transparency, allowing light to penetrate deep into the workspace while providing the necessary acoustic separation for private offices and conference rooms.
Project Execution
Our design process includes full technical documentation, covering MEP (Mechanical, Electrical, and Plumbing) planning and acoustic treatments. This ensures that the aesthetic intent of the design is supported by the infrastructure required for modern business operations. In our work for Komet India, we utilized a central staircase and open mezzanines to create a cohesive, collaborative environment. These elements foster a connection between floors, turning a standard office layout into a unified, functional volume.
